About Zhongxing Wang

Zhongxing Wang is a scholar working on Anesthesiology and Pain Medicine, Developmental Neuroscience and Endocrinology, having authored 47 papers that have together received 652 indexed citations. Recurring topics across this work include Anesthesia and Sedative Agents (6 papers), Anesthesia and Neurotoxicity Research (5 papers) and Escherichia coli research studies (5 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(221 citations), Molecular Medicine (65 citations) and Endocrinology (60 citations). Zhongxing Wang has collaborated with scholars based in China, United States and Australia. Frequent co-authors include Wenqi Huang, Xiaoying Cai, Kebing Wang, Yudi Kuang, Jun‐Qi Zhang, Zhiqiang Fang, Gang Chen, Wulin Tan, Xiangkai Zhuge and Jianjun Dai. Their work appears in journals such as Nucleic Acids Research, Langmuir and Scientific Reports.
